Mohammed Kudus named MoTM in Ajax’s 3-0 win against RKC Waalwijk

Published on: 20 September 2020

Ghana international Mohammed Kudus has been named the ‘Man of the Match’ after impressing for Ajax Amsterdam in the team’s deserved 3-0 win against RKC Waalwijk.

Having missed his team’s season opener last week, Mohammed Kudus was handed a starting role today to face RKC Waalwijk.

The Ghana international enjoyed a very good game and impacted positively to help Ajax cruise to a deserved 3-0 win at the end of the 90 minutes.

On the matchday, Dusan Tadic and Zakaria Labyad scored in the first half for the winners before Lisandro Martinez added the final goal in the second half.

Mohammed Kudus, 20, lasted the entire duration of today’s fixture and picked up a yellow card in the first half.

Assessing the performance of players on the matchday, the teenage sensation has been named the Man of the Match.

The former Right to Dreams Academy boy joined Ajax this summer from Danish Superliga outfit FC Nordsjallenad. He is expected to play a key role for the Dutch giants throughout the campaign.
